Trials of the Elements

As Kiera and her companions emerged from the depths of the cavern, the weight of the Oracle's words hung heavy in the air. The quest to find the Elemental Guardians weighed heavily on their minds, but they were filled with a renewed sense of purpose and determination.

Thistlewick fluttered anxiously at Kiera's side, his wings quivering with excitement. "I can't believe we're actually going to seek out the Elemental Guardians," he exclaimed, his voice filled with awe. "It's like something out of a legend!"

Kiera nodded, her heart swelling with anticipation. The Elemental Guardians were legendary beings said to hold the power to shape the very elements themselves—earth, air, fire, and water. To seek their aid was a daunting task, but one that she knew they must undertake if they were to stand any chance of defeating the darkness that threatened to consume Lumaria.

With a sense of resolve, Kiera turned to her companions, her voice steady and resolute. "We must begin our search for the Elemental Guardians at once," she declared, her eyes shining with determination. "But first, we must gather our strength and prepare ourselves for the trials that lie ahead."

Her companions nodded in agreement, their expressions filled with determination. With a collective sense of purpose, they set off once more, their eyes fixed on the horizon and their hearts filled with hope.

Their journey led them deep into the heart of Lumaria, through dense forests and treacherous mountain passes, until they came upon a vast expanse of desert stretching out before them. The sun beat down mercilessly upon the barren landscape, its rays shimmering off the sand dunes like waves of liquid gold.

Thistlewick chirped nervously, his tiny form trembling with apprehension. "I don't like the look of this place, Kiera," he murmured, his voice barely above a whisper. "It feels... inhospitable."

Kiera nodded, her senses on high alert as they ventured further into the desert. The air was thick with a palpable sense of heat and dust, and the landscape seemed to stretch out endlessly in all directions.

Suddenly, a fierce wind kicked up, whipping sand into their faces and obscuring their vision. Kiera shielded her eyes with her arm, squinting against the swirling sandstorm as she pressed onward.

As they struggled through the storm, they stumbled upon a towering sand dune rising up from the desert floor like a mountain. With a collective effort, they began to climb, their footsteps sinking into the soft sand with each step.

At last, they reached the summit, where they were greeted by a breathtaking sight—a vast oasis stretching out before them, its shimmering waters a stark contrast to the harsh desert landscape.

Thistlewick gasped in awe, his eyes wide with wonder. "Look, Kiera!" he exclaimed, his voice filled with excitement. "It's beautiful!"

Kiera smiled, her heart swelling with gratitude. The oasis was a welcome respite from the relentless heat of the desert, and she knew that they would find solace and strength in its cool waters.

As they made their way down to the oasis, they were greeted by a group of nomads—travelers who had made their home amidst the shifting sands of the desert. They welcomed Kiera and her companions with open arms, offering them food, water, and shelter from the harsh elements.

In return, Kiera shared their tale of seeking out the Elemental Guardians and restoring balance to Lumaria. The nomads listened intently, their faces filled with awe and reverence.

"You seek the Elemental Guardians?" one of the nomads exclaimed, his eyes wide with wonder. "Then you must journey to the Cave of Whispers—a place of great power and mystery, hidden deep within the heart of the desert."

Kiera's heart quickened with excitement at the mention of the Cave of Whispers. If what the nomad said was true, then it could be the key to unlocking the secrets of the Elemental Guardians and fulfilling their quest.

With a sense of purpose burning in her heart, Kiera and her companions set off once more, their eyes fixed on the horizon and their spirits buoyed by the promise of adventure that lay ahead. For they were the champions of Lumaria, and their journey was far from over.

As they ventured deeper into the desert, the landscape around them grew more treacherous, with towering sandstone cliffs and winding ravines stretching out before them. But they pressed onward, their determination unwavering in the face of adversity.

At last, they reached the entrance to the Cave of Whispers—a dark, foreboding cavern nestled deep within the heart of the desert. With a sense of trepidation, they stepped inside, their footsteps echoing through the silent darkness.

As they ventured deeper into the cavern, they were greeted by a chorus of whispers—a soft, melodic voice that seemed to echo from the very walls themselves. "Welcome, travelers," it murmured, its words laced with an otherworldly beauty. "Welcome to the Cave of Whispers."

Kiera's heart raced with excitement as she stepped forward, her eyes wide with wonder. Could this be the place they had been searching for? The place where they would find the key to unlocking the power of the Elemental Guardians?

With a sense of anticipation burning in her heart, Kiera and her companions pressed onward, their eyes fixed on the darkness that lay ahead. For they knew that their journey was far from over, and that the trials they faced within the Cave of Whispers would test their courage and strength like never before.
